Let $\mathrm{O}(0,0), \mathrm{P}(3,4), \mathrm{Q}(6,0)$ be the vertices of the triangle OPQ . The point R inside the triangle OPQ is such that the triangles $O P R, P Q R, O Q R$ are of equal area. The coordinates of $R$ are
Select the correct option:
A
$\left(\frac{4}{3}, 3\right)$
B
$\left(3, \frac{2}{3}\right)$
C
$\left(3, \frac{4}{3}\right)$
D
$\left(\frac{4}{3}, \frac{2}{3}\right)$
